“…Clonal complex 11 (CC11) denotes the STs differed from ST11 by one housekeeper gene, including ST11, ST258, ST340, ST437, ST757, ST855, and others. CC11 is an epidemic K. pneumoniae clonal complex [ 1 ], and cases with the CC11 strain faced more severe forms of drug resistance and treatment challenges than other clonal complexes [ 8 ]. KPC-producing [ 1 ] and NDM-producing [ 9 ] CC11 have been reported in China, and no one reported OXA-48-type-producing CC11 clone in China although a clonal dissemination of OXA-48-producing ST147 and ST383 [ 4 ] as well as two clonal disseminations of OXA-232-producing ST15 have been reported in China [ 2 , 3 ].…”
